A POSTDOCTORAL POSITION is available immediately at Texas Tech University Health Science Center El Paso, Paul L. Foster School of Medicine. We are looking for a highly motivated candidate with a good knowledge of and great interest in immunology, cellular and molecular biology. The laboratory functions as an integrated translational research program with the goal of designing and developing cell-based delivery and immunotherapy strategies for the CNS infectious diseases, degenerative diseases and the brain cancer treatment and prevention. The project is focused on therapeutic regulatory molecules and lymphocytes based immunotherapy, especially studying the brain immune response mechanism used mouse model of human diseases. Ongoing studies involve (1) analysis and utilization of both characterized and newly found molecules from the anti-viral neuroprotection and anti-cancer immunology; (2) molecular and cellular characterization of lymphocyte and brain cell interactions; (3) the development of new animal models that can be employed in preclinical study to most reflect human clinical trials.

DUTIES
The candidate is expected to develop or contribute substantially to the design and planning of his/her research activities under the framework outlined above. He/she is expected to take full responsibility for the conduct of his/her studies and for any member of staff or student assigned to his/her project.
QUALIFICATIONS
The preferred candidate should have a Ph.D. or M.D./Ph.D. and possess a strong background in the area of immunology and molecular biology and/or the Central Nervous System (CNS) infectious diseases, degenerative diseases and brain cancer. He/she must have the ability and willingness to contribute skills and knowledge to the broader aims of the work of a research team to conduct research activities that are required.
The selected candidate will have sound knowledge and expertise in at least six of the following key technologies commonly used in cellular and molecular immunology: animal model of CNS disease/injury, cell culture, multi-parameter flow-cytometry, ELISpot, ELISA, MULTIPLEX assays, proliferation assays, cell-depletion strategies, PCR, RT-PCR, Western blot, and microarray analysis.
Desired skills and experience include a proven ability to think innovatively (for example, development of new assays), broader knowledge on the neuroimmunology or immunology of infectious diseases and experience as a team leader.
